Did the employee actually speak of half floors? These do not exist in building law. For your property, an attic extension also does not seem to be permitted (II and not II+D).
02.jpg: point 0.3.1; but your plan does not contradict that
You should definitely draw your property to scale (obtain and enlarge the cadastral map or use Bayernatlas) and transfer the building boundaries to it to scale. It seems to me that your house does not fit into the building window, so all your efforts could be in vain. Also note that the house must maintain a minimum distance of 3m from the boundary.
